From AudioFile
For the early elementary age group, this book-and-cassette gets high marks. Kaye reads this informational book about an area in Australia in a clear, polished, professional voice, void of almost any accent. Her pace is slow, the tone bright and enthusiastic. The sound effects greatly increase the success of the recording. There are sea lions barking, sea gulls calling, crickets humming and a raging forest fire. The musical accompaniment ranges from lullaby strains to energetic instrumentals. The last page is a fold-out with pictures of the area, but it gets bent easily. A.G.H. (c) AudioFile, Portland, Maine

Card catalog description
As morning comes to Kangaroo Island following a thunderstorm, a mother kangaroo finds her lost baby and a burned eucalyptus tree sprouts buds and becomes a new home for animals.
